The Latest Trends in Application Development

Imagine you’re exploring a marketplace, looking for the perfect tools to keep your business ahead of the curve. Every vendor you meet offers something new and exciting. That’s exactly how it feels in the world of application development today. At Flynaut, we’re your guide in this vibrant market, helping you choose the right tools to build applications that not only meet the demands of today but also anticipate the needs of tomorrow. Join us as we explore the key trends shaping the future of development: microservices architecture, cloud-native applications, and low-code platforms. Together, we'll uncover how these latest trends in application development can transform your approach and keep you leading the way.
 

What are Microservices?

Microservices architecture has emerged as a transformative approach in global application development. But what exactly are microservices? In essence, microservices architecture involves breaking down large, complex applications into numerous small, self-contained services. These services can be developed, deployed, and scaled independently, each aligning with specific business capabilities and interacting with others through APIs. The benefits of microservices are numerous and compelling:
 
  1. Scalability: Individual services can be scaled independently, allowing for more efficient resource distribution across the application.
  2. Flexibility: Teams have the freedom to use different technologies and programming languages, selecting the best tool for each service, which leads to more innovative solutions.
  3. Faster Development and Deployment: With smaller, focused teams working on specific services in parallel, the development process is accelerated, leading to quicker deployment.
  4. Improved Fault Isolation: Issues that arise within one service are less likely to impact the entire application, enhancing overall system stability.
  5. Easier Maintenance and Updates: Services can be updated, replaced, or scaled without affecting the rest of the system, resulting in more manageable and responsive applications.
However, adopting microservices architecture also presents challenges, particularly in service management and ensuring seamless inter-service communication. It's essential for organizations to assess their readiness and capability to implement this architecture effectively, as its benefits are most fully realized when aligned with the organization’s specific needs and infrastructure.
 

How Can Your Business Benefit from Microservices and Low-Code Platforms?

A cloud computing concept with a cityscape inside, symbolizing scalability, flexibility, faster development and deployment, improved fault isolation, and easier maintenance and updates. A person typing on a laptop with a cloud symbol surrounded by various digital icons, representing cloud computing and data storage. The integration of microservices and low-code platforms into your business strategy can offer substantial advantages. Microservices provide the scalability, flexibility, and speed necessary for modern application development, while low-code platforms enable faster and more accessible development, even for those without extensive coding expertise.
Businesses that adopt microservices architecture can create applications that are not only easier to manage but also more adaptable to change. This adaptability is crucial in today’s fast-paced market, where the ability to pivot quickly can mean the difference between success and obsolescence.
Low-code platforms, on the other hand, empower non-technical users to contribute to application development, reducing the reliance on scarce and expensive coding talent. This approach accelerates the development cycle, allowing businesses to respond more quickly to market demands and emerging opportunities.
Curious about how microservices and low-code platforms can transform your business? Reach out to us with your questions and explore the possibilities!
 

How Prepared Is Your Organization to Harness the Full Potential of Microservices, Cloud-Native Applications, and Low-Code Platforms to Drive Innovation and Stay Ahead?

To fully harness the benefits of microservices, cloud-native applications, and low-code platforms, your organization must be prepared to invest in the necessary skills, processes, and technologies. This preparation involves embracing new cultures and practices, such as DevOps, CI/CD, and containerization, which are essential for creating applications that are scalable, resilient, and flexible.
Cloud-native development, in particular, requires a fundamental shift in how organizations build, deploy, and manage applications. Traditional development practices must evolve to leverage the full power of cloud environments, including the adoption of microservices and containerization, which together enable greater scalability and efficiency.
Organizations must also invest in training and development to ensure their teams have the skills needed to succeed in this new environment. This investment not only prepares the organization for the future but also positions it to lead in an increasingly competitive market. Got questions about leveraging microservices and cloud-native solutions? Let’s discuss how your organization can get ahead. Contact us today!

 

Are You Ready to Explore How Microservices and Cloud-Native Strategies Can Significantly Improve Your Scalability, Flexibility, and Time-to-Market?

The adoption of microservices and cloud-native strategies has the potential to transform your business by enhancing scalability, flexibility, and speed to market. These strategies allow organizations to utilize resources more efficiently, respond more quickly to market changes, and deliver products and services that better meet customer needs.
Microservices enable businesses to break down complex applications into smaller, more manageable components, allowing for faster development and deployment. Cloud-native strategies, meanwhile, leverage the full power of cloud computing to create applications that are not only scalable but also resilient and adaptable.
By integrating these approaches, your organization can stay ahead of the competition, reduce time-to-market, and ensure that your applications are always ready to meet the demands of today’s dynamic market.

 

What If Embracing Low-Code Platforms Could Bridge the Gap Between Your Business Needs and IT Capabilities, Enabling Faster and More Cost-Effective Application Development?

Low-code platforms offer a powerful solution for bridging the gap between business needs and IT capabilities. These platforms provide visual development environments, pre-built templates, and automated code generation, enabling faster and more cost-effective application development.
By reducing the need for extensive coding expertise, low-code platforms empower business users to take a more active role in the development process. This involvement not only speeds up development but also ensures that the resulting applications are more closely aligned with business goals and objectives.
Moreover, low-code platforms allow organizations to rapidly prototype and iterate on applications enabling them to respond more quickly to changing market conditions and emerging opportunities. This agility is essential in today’s fast-paced business environment, where the ability to innovate quickly can be a key differentiator.

Conclusion

It is essential for organizations to stay ahead of these trends for delivering solutions that revolutionize businesses and organizations. By adopting microservices architecture, becoming cloud-native, and leveraging low-code platforms, organizations can build applications that are robust, efficient, and usercentric.
As the landscape of application development continues to evolve, it’s clear that these trends will play a critical role in shaping the future. The integration of microservices, cloud-native development, and low-code platforms will enable organizations to create applications that are more scalable, flexible, and responsive to market demands.
So, how ready is your business to embrace these cutting-edge trends in application development? Flynaut is here to help you navigate this exciting landscape. Are you ready to take the next step toward innovation and success? Get in touch with us today to explore how we can help bring your vision to life.

Share This

Subscribe to our newsletter

Flynaut produces a variety of high-quality & creative digital applications. In the past 17 years, our team has designed, developed, and launched over 400 successful apps for companies and start-ups around the world.

Flynaut boasts three arenas of expertise:

Strategic Product Consulting — we help companies develop market-tested strategies around their digital products, ranging from revenue models to user acquisition plans. Loyalty-Driving Design — when we design mobile applications for our clients, we laser focus on a use experience that will forge and grow loyalty with their current - and future - customers. Savvy Engineering — our seasoned team builds products for the “real world” - our applications are built to scale and evolve as consumer trends shift.

Our 120-person team is headquartered in Charlotte, NC, and is organized into two divisions serving Enterprise and startup clients.

Become The Go-To Resource In Your Niche, A Market Leader And A Better-Known Brand Today!

Our prolific productivity knows no bounds! We’ve established a remarkable record of success over the past decade, delivering 700+ world-class mobile applications, websites and other digital products—with both speed & quality.